Super BIM: 7 award-winning BIM/VDC-driven projects

BD+C

The AIA''s Technology in Architectural Practice (TAP) Knowledge Community recently announced the winners of the 2014 AIA TAP BIM Awards. Launched in 2005, the program honors projects that best harness building information modeling and virtual design and construction tools and processes, and related innovations.

Enhanced Analytical Model in Autodesk Revit 2014

BIM & Beam

In this release the structural analytical model was improved in several different areas. You can find enhancements to help create and manage the structural analytical model, such as better visibility and greater control over the analytical model.

BIM / BLM Onology – Building Information Modeling / Built-environment Life-cycle Management – 2014

Building Information Management

Ontology is now a rapidly evolving science in response to increasing complex information systems and/or “big data” Specific to the built-environment life-cycle management BLM / BIM, ontology is a fundamental requirement as it’s needed to establish robust, coherent, and consistent representations of ever-changing information.
